While the boys were cutting hearts and mummifying the house in them, I was busy making a heart garland. It's so easy you just need paper, scissors and a sewing machine. And kids will definitely enjoy sewing these with you on the machine.
Heart Garland:
- find some interesting paper to cut into heart shapes, I recycled an old music book for a first year drummer, Yes, I am the mother of a drummer, a 17 year old drummer...and I'm still sane, mostly
- after cutting as many hearts as you want to hang together, start sewing them, leave some thread at the beginning to hang it with, then leave a little space between each or over lap them-I like the way these looked separated a bit
- when you have sewn all the hearts together continue sewing for a few inches to give yourself a nice long end to hang it with
- hang where ever you need a little love!
